Coutts Forum for Philanthropy

Welcome to our series of roundtable discussions on philanthropy. By attending one or more sessions, you and your family may benefit from the opportunity to network amongst other philanthropists and seek advice from selected professionals on a whole range of issues. These events are designed to be 'hands-on' as well as to stimulate some lively and wide-ranging debates.

We have produced a calendar of events for 2008 which highlights the dates of these forums taking place around the country. The first events are arranged for February 2008 and will be taking place in Leeds and London.

The sessions are suitable for philanthropists who are giving or thinking of giving over ten thousand pounds per annum. As places are limited, please let us know if you and/or other family members would like to attend by contacting the team.

Individual speakers will kick off each session before engaging the group in a wider debate. Full details of the speakers, dates and venues can be found on the following pages. 

As a company with a philanthropic heritage, we know one or two things about philanthropy ourselves and look forward to sharing our own experience with you.
